Snapchat all set to launch its new feature Remix

Tik-Tok competitors invaded the norms which the social media platform flared and gained a large number of followers and downloads. Instagram tried to recreate Tik-Tok through its feature named ‘reel’ and now Snapchat trying its hand on Tik-Tok’s duet feature.

The feature has launched into external testing, confirms Snap. It follows Instagram’s public test of a similarly named “Remix” feature focused on Reels content.

It’s been spotted working on a TikTok Duets-like feature called “Remix,” designed for replying to Snaps. This feature will allow users to create new content using their friends’ Snaps — a “remix,” that is.

the feature will allow users to reply to a friend’s story with a remixed Snap. To do so, you can record your Snap alongside the original as it plays much like a TikTok Duet.

In its Remix feature, Snapchat users are presented with a screen where they can choose from a variety of options for combining Snaps — including the side-by-side and top-and-bottom formats, as well as others like where content is overlaid or where you could react to a Snap.
